Tish Poorman

Program Director

Tish Poorman has worked in the performing arts field for over 30 years. She was the founder of the first children’s theater in Collier County, The SW Florida Children’s Theater from 1988-2002, and also implemented many after-school theater programs throughout the area. After a short break from theater she opened Children For The Arts in 2004. Ms. Poorman also provides private vocal/acting classes for children and adults as well as working with voice over actors. She has worked with artists who have appeared on The Voice and American Idol, and also works in the recording and music video field.

Zachary Pachol

Production Consultant

Zachary has been with Children For The Arts for over a decade starting as an actor and progressed to directing some years later. His resume has amassed more than 45 performances including Snoopy/It's the Great Pumpkin, Charlie Brown; Willy Wonka/Charlie and the Chocolate Factory; Super Soldier/Nabucco; Ensemble/Les Misérables, Stephano/The Tempest; Touchstone/As You Like It; Benedict/Much Ado About Nothing and many more. He has directed over 15 shows for CFTA and is now acting as Production Consultant.

Kayleigh Campo

PProduction and Music Director 

Kayleigh is thrilled to be working once again with Children For The Arts. Kayleigh got her start in acting with CFTA in 2008 and continued her love of the theatre teaching and directing youth theatre. She has toured with The Missoula Children's Theatre, directed shows for the Ft. Myers Theatre, Center for the Arts Bonita Springs, and is the drama teacher at Pine Ridge Middle School. Kayleigh has been in numerous productions, holds a BFA in Musical Theatre, and loves the connection with children and the impact that is made when they immerse themselves in the performing arts.
